Actually, I have the link available for 2 of my 3 amex cards. This functionality has been discussed on the forums recently and Amex has started to allow reallocation, as long as both accounts involved in the reallocation has been open of at least 12 months. The problem is now they process the reallocation differently in the past and require that you give updated HHI information before you can submit the reallocation request.

AMEX does allow reallocation of CL.  At least I have the link on one card on my account.  But, when I tried to do it, I was declined because the other of my lines was "too new".  When I called for an explanation of "too new", I was told that both cards involved had to be 13 months old or older in order to reallocate.  YMMV.
